Top teams set up big clash |
|
|
|
Monday, 05 March 2007 |
|
After the games on Saturday two teams now stand out head and shoulders above the others after again both having decisive wins. Druid Hills easily accounted for Decatur running out winners by 67 points and Midtown kept up their early promise by outplaying Roswell to the tune of 92 points. Last years Premiership team after two games now sits on the bottom of the ladder alongside Decatur. This sets up a big game in Round 3 when Midtown play Druid Hills on March 17th. Druid Hills Highlanders 4.1 7.3 13.7 18.9 (122) Decatur Devils 2.2 4.4 5.5 8.7 (55) Roswell Rebels 0.1 0.2 1.3 3.8 (26) Midtown Bombers 6.3 12.3 16.7 18.10 (118) Match reports are here now.
